- Best in the segment for CruisingI chose this bike for the comfort in city as well as long rides. I have driven this bike for more 40K Km and I am happy with this bike. The only concern I have is about the safety as the leg guard is too short compared to the other bike and the as there is a gap from where you rest you feet for shifting gear and braking as it does not cover the feet. The ride is good, it is low maintenance if you take good care of the bike, also long routes are amazing as there is no fatigue. Cons is just about the handling as this a cruiser bike so it is not everyone ride. Definitely this bike is for the people who like comfort low maintanence. If you get a hand on the back seat then the comfort is next level. The mileage is good in the city and if you go for a long ride then you will get a good mileage which can be 40 plus.Read More2 3

- Good bike but room for improvement is huge.My dad bought this bike for daily commute because of the design and comfort this bike offers. It is a low height bike, which proves easy to ride and is good for long highway rides. Overall the ride is comfortable for rides. The ride is average in my opinion. I have had problems with the tyres. It is 2025 and in my opinion and this bike still comes with tube tyres. Bajaj should upgrade it to have alloy wheels. The engine seems underpowered for a cruiser, and performance wise it is bad. It has less features than other bikes which is a bit shameful for a bike in this age. The pillion comfort is also compromised but the comfort of the driver is very good. It is a comfortable bike for a solo rider, but the unavailability of tubeless tyres for the bike makes it less reliable for long rides. The service centre here at Chandigarh is very poor, but the overall servicing is cheap, around Rs.1000 to1500 for a normal service. I would recommend this bike to people who are looking for a comfortable ride and not for long distances. At times the tyres can be a problem as when they get punctured you will have to carry it, and carrying a bike this heavy is very tough. Overall if Bajaj would update this bike with some features like traction control, tubeless tyres and a better pillion seat, it can be a great choice.Read More5 2
